Effective Search Engine Optimization Techniques

The global SEO market is booming and is expected to reach $122.11 billion by 2028. This shows how vital it is to sharpen your SEO skills to get top rankings and drive business growth. SEO is all about keywords, on-page tweaks, and building links to boost your online visibility and trust.

Keyword Research

Finding out what your audience is looking for is key to successful search engine optimization techniques. Doing top-notch keyword research helps you discover the exact phrases and terms your audience uses. This allows you to craft your content so it directly answers their questions. Given that 49% of online shoppers start their journey on search engines like Google, doing thorough keyword research is essential.

On-Page Optimization

On-page optimization makes your content not just relevant, but also well-structured for search engines to notice. It involves adding targeted keywords in the right places like title tags, meta descriptions, and URLs. It also means making your content valuable and linking it internally. Since organic searches drive 53% of web traffic, focusing on on-page elements is a must.

Link Building

Link building is all about connecting with trustworthy sources for better rankings. It means getting backlinks from authoritative websites, having online reviews, and strong brand signals. This strategy confirms your site's credibility, improving its position in search results. Link building is vital for enhancing your online visibility over time, showcasing the power of this SEO method.

Email Marketing Automation to Drive Conversions

Email marketing automation boosts conversion rates through targeted and personalized content. It lets marketers save time by automating repetitive tasks. This allows them to concentrate on strategy and creating original content.

Automation in your strategy lets you set up actions triggered by customer behaviors or events. For instance, automated emails for seasonal sales hit the mark every time. Tools like Constant Contact have easy automation builders, although some features might be limited.

Segmenting your email list is key to automation. It means sending messages that meet each receiver's individual needs. This approach increases engagement and the chances of making a sale. With automation, you can send the right kind of emails at each step of the customer's journey.

Personalizing your emails is very important. By customizing emails based on what the receiver likes or does, you make them more relevant. This builds a stronger connection and can lead to more sales.

Automation also gives you detailed reports on how your campaigns are doing. This information helps you make your email marketing even better. Platforms like Benchmark Email and BenchmarkONE offer tools to help with this across different channels.

In short, email marketing automation is a smart investment. It helps you keep leads interested and strengthens your relationship with current customers. Regular, tailored updates can increase loyalty and keep customers coming back.

Understanding H1 and H2 Tags for SEO and User Experience

Web development and digital marketing gain a lot from properly using H1 and H2 tags. Without them, users quickly get lost. They spend about 10 to 15 seconds searching for info. This can increase bounce rates and lower search rankings.

Following best practices is key. For example, use one H1 tag per page and up to four H2 tags. This makes your content easy to navigate and boosts search engine optimization. A 2,000-word blog post usually has four H2 tags. They help readers move through the article smoothly.

Clear headings help users find what they need faster. This keeps them engaged and on your site longer. Google likes this and may rank your site higher because of it.

Headings are not just for SEO. About 70% of people using screen readers depend on them to explore web pages. This makes headings key for accessibility too. Meeting WCAG 2.4.2 Level A guidelines shows you care about all users.

Smart use of H1 and H2 tags makes your content clearer for everyone. They help readers and search engines understand your page. This improves readability and your site's SEO. It ensures your website serves a wide audience well.
